From eenriquez at snf.stanford.edu Wed Oct 7 18:38:55 2009 From: eenriquez at snf.stanford.edu (eenriquez at snf.stanford.edu) Date: Wed, 7 Oct 2009 18:38:55 -0700 Subject: Comment amtetcher SNF 2009-10-07 18:38:54: Maintenace work Message-ID: Replaced the manometer with a newly calibrated manometer. Installed a newly calibrated SF6 MFC. Able to flow SF6 but the shutoff valve (pneumatic valve) is stuck open. It looks like there is a problem with the digital output board. Will continue to troubleshoot. Shutoff the manual valve and pumped out the SF6 line to ensure that SF6 will not flow in the system. Also need to zero the MFC because it reads 1 sccm with no gas in the line. Took out and measured the quartz viewport port. Will order new windows tomorrow. The new manometer might effect your process. Please qualify your process before comitting your wafers. From eenriquez at snf.stanford.edu Wed Oct 21 18:06:06 2009 From: eenriquez at snf.stanford.edu (eenriquez at snf.stanford.edu) Date: Wed, 21 Oct 2009 18:06:06 -0700 Subject: Problem amtetcher SNF 2009-10-21 13:48:29: rough TC <20 Message-ID: Training issue. The message "rough TC< 20" is just the message displayed when the Pressure button is pressed. The Pressure button, when pressed repeatedly will cycle through and display various pressure gauge readings on the system.
